Systematic Data Collection and Analysis for Actionable Insights
Collecting and analyzing user data is indispensable for enhancing the user experience and making well-informed, data-driven design decisions. While various methodologies exist, three widely used and highly effective approaches for gathering and analyzing user data stand out: surveys, lead-generation forms, and comprehensive form analytics.
Surveys
Surveys remain one of the most efficient and versatile methods for collecting user data, offering both quantitative and qualitative insights. Conducting a UX survey is an excellent way to gather feedback on how users interact with and perceive a website, mobile application, or software. This tool allows designers to understand users’ motivations for using a particular product, solicit quick feedback on new features or beta versions, and assess overall user satisfaction levels.
Effective UX surveys are meticulously designed to avoid bias, ensure clarity, and target specific aspects of the user journey. They can range from short, in-context pop-ups asking about a specific feature to comprehensive post-interaction questionnaires. Quantitative data from surveys (e.g., satisfaction scores, likelihood to recommend) can be statistically analyzed to identify trends and benchmarks. Qualitative data (open-ended comments) requires thematic analysis to uncover recurring pain points, unexpected delights, and actionable suggestions.
However, it is crucial to recognize that while UX surveys provide valuable insights into user perceptions and stated experiences, they may not fully capture all nuances of actual user behavior, latent usability issues, or unarticulated needs. Users may not always accurately recall or articulate their interactions, or they may be influenced by social desirability bias. For a more thorough exploration of these areas, complementary methods such as usability studies, which involve direct observation, often prove more effective.
Lead-Generation Forms
Lead-generation forms, prevalent across websites and applications, serve a dual purpose: they gather contact information from users expressing interest in a product, service, or content, and simultaneously provide a wealth of data that informs the UX design process. The very act of a user filling out such a form indicates a level of intent and engagement, making the data collected particularly valuable.
Information garnered from lead-generation forms—ranging from demographics and professional roles to specific interests and stated needs—offers valuable insights into user preferences and behaviors. This data can inform user segmentation, persona development, and content personalization strategies. Analyzing the types of information users are willing to provide, and the points at which they abandon a lead form, can reveal critical insights into trust, perceived value, and the optimal length and complexity of forms. For instance, if a high abandonment rate is observed when asking for phone numbers, it might suggest privacy concerns or a perception that the request is premature in the user journey.
Form Analytics
To maximize the value derived from data collected through surveys and lead-generation forms, it is imperative to conduct a comprehensive analysis by implementing dedicated form analytics tools. This method provides granular insights into how visitors on a website are interacting with online forms. Form analytics goes beyond simple completion rates, delving into specific metrics such as:
- Initiation Rate: The percentage of users who start filling out a form after viewing it.
- Completion Rate: The percentage of users who successfully submit the form.
- Abandonment Rate: The percentage of users who start but do not complete the form, and at which specific field they drop off.
- Time to Complete: The average time users spend on the form, indicating potential areas of friction or confusion.
- Field-Time Analysis: How long users spend on individual fields, highlighting problematic or complex inputs.
- Error Rates: Which fields trigger validation errors most frequently, suggesting issues with instructions, format, or field type.
- Correction Rates: How often users go back to correct previously entered information.
- Refill Rates: How often users leave a form and return later to complete it.
By meticulously understanding users’ actions and intentions at each step, UX designers can develop an appropriate design strategy that directly aligns with visitor behaviors. This data-driven approach allows for targeted improvements, such as simplifying problematic fields, enhancing error messages, or restructuring the form flow to reduce cognitive load. Tools like Hotjar, Google Analytics (with form tracking), and specialized form analytics platforms offer visualizations like heatmaps and session recordings that complement quantitative data, providing a holistic view of user interaction.
Translating Insights into Design Iterations
Shaping UX design decisions based on insights gleaned from form data requires a comprehensive, iterative approach. It involves developing a deep understanding of the data’s complexities and accurately interpreting its implications. UX designers must look beyond surface-level observations, delving into the underlying patterns and user behaviors that the form data reveals. This often means identifying the "why" behind the "what"—why are users abandoning a specific field? Is it confusing? Too personal? Or simply unnecessary?
By effectively leveraging this information, UX designers can initiate targeted improvements to both the user interface and the overall user experience. This process encompasses not only enhancing visual aesthetics but, more crucially, understanding and optimizing the functional aspects that drive user interactions. For instance, if form analytics reveals that users consistently struggle with a particular date input field, the design team might explore alternative input methods (e.g., a calendar picker instead of manual entry) or provide clearer formatting instructions. If a multi-page form shows high abandonment on the third page, it might indicate that the information requested there is perceived as intrusive or that the progress indicator is unclear.
The iterative cycle involves:
- Data Review: Analyzing all collected form insights (surveys, lead-gen data, analytics).
- Hypothesis Generation: Formulating specific assumptions about why certain behaviors are occurring and how design changes could address them.
- Design Iteration: Implementing changes based on these hypotheses (e.g., reducing fields, rephrasing labels, improving error messages).
- A/B Testing: Deploying different versions of the form to a subset of users to empirically test which design performs better against key metrics (e.g., completion rates, time to complete).
- Implementation and Monitoring: Rolling out the successful design and continuously monitoring its performance to identify further opportunities for optimization.
This systematic approach ensures that design decisions are not arbitrary but are instead driven by empirical evidence, leading to continuous improvements in usability, efficiency, and user satisfaction.

Ensuring Accessibility and Inclusivity
Digital accessibility ensures seamless interactions with online platforms for individuals of all physical and cognitive abilities. Products must be designed to be accessible to all users, irrespective of their age, spoken language, geographical location, or physical and technical capabilities. Consequently, prioritizing accessibility and inclusive design is not merely a legal or ethical obligation but a strategic imperative when crafting a product or website’s user experience.
Adhering to guidelines such as the Web Content Accessibility Guidelines (WCAG) ensures that digital content is perceivable, operable, understandable, and robust. By guaranteeing that a product or website is accessible and inclusive, businesses can expand their reach to a wider audience, enhance user engagement, boost conversion rates (as more users can complete tasks), ensure legal compliance, and foster a reputation as an ethical and responsible brand. Inclusive design considers a spectrum of human abilities and circumstances, from visual impairments requiring screen reader compatibility to motor impairments necessitating keyboard navigation, and cognitive differences benefiting from clear, predictable interfaces.
